3D Hand & Feet Castings, Created With Love
We can cast babies from around 23/24 weeks up to 1 year (depending on weight and a few other factors) We can visit at hospitals, funeral homes or hospices and recommend that casts are taken as soon as possible.
The process involves pushing babies feet into a pot of alginate. Alginate is completely safe and non toxic, it is used by dentists for mouth moulds. We then wait a few minutes for the alginate to go hard. Once hard, we then gently wriggle babies hands/feet out of the mould. We will then fill the mould with plaster and then once this has set, we demould it. The plaster has to be left to dry fully before finishing and painting. The whole process can take up to 12 weeks before the casts are returned. The casts are provided in beautiful Memorial Boxes. Please note that the casts are collection only.

How does the Memorial Casting Service work?
- Contact with our team is made via yourselves, the hospital or the Funeral Director.
- If our criteria for casting your baby is met one of our casters will come out to meet your baby and you (if you’d like to attend, you don’t have to) If you are present you are welcome to hold baby as he/ she is cast and photos are permitted for extra memories. If you are not present the caster will look after your baby with love and respect and make sure the dignity of your baby is maintained throughout, keeping them wrapped up safe and only exposing what is needed for their casting. We leave baby as we found them with their teddies and belongings.
- We will leave a “Memory Making” and “Funeral List” for parents written by bereaved parents, that may be useful for the next steps as well as information about our support services that you can use as you need to.
- After casting it will take around 12 weeks to be fully finished. Please note that the casts are collection only. We do not post in any cases due to risk of any damages occurring in transit.
- You will be asked to choose the colour you would like the casts painted (silver, gold/ bronze, white, blue or pink)
- You will be contacted to arrange the collection a week in advance to the collection date.
- Castings are displayed in MM memory boxes, with white tissue paper.
- After collection the team will be in touch to make sure you are happy with everything and discuss the MM support services that are on offer to you.
